This handbook offers a comprehensive treatise on Grammatical Evolution (GE), a grammar-based Evolutionary Algorithm that employs a function to map binary strings into higher-level structures such as programs. GE's simplicity and modular nature make it a very flexible tool. Since its introduction almost twenty years ago, researchers have applied it to a vast range of problem domains, including financial modelling, parallel programming and genetics. Similarly, much work has been conducted to exploit and understand the nature of its mapping scheme, triggering additional research on everything from different grammars to alternative mappers to initialization. What is the human mind, and how does it work? These questions have occupied humanity since antiquity but have only recently received rigorous scientific investigation. Cognitive architectures are complex software programs whose goal is to approach human-like behavior on a wide variety of tasks. This is accomplished by employing human-like, or at least human-plausible, mechanisms within an integrated framework that is claimed representative of human cognitive, perceptual, and movement capabilities. By examining how close their behavior is to human, they help us understand how the human mind and brain work. They contribute to our understanding as computational models that can be tested and whose details in turn provide insights on new aspects of the human brain and mind. This field of cognitive architectures emerged at the intersection of artificial intelligence and cognitive science and in less than fifty years has spawned hundreds of projects. As industrial automation systems become reliant on digital technologies, they face growing threats from sophisticated cyberattacks. Traditional cybersecurity measures often struggle to keep up with the evolving threat landscape, leaving critical infrastructure vulnerable. AI-enhanced cybersecurity offers a promising solution by leveraging machine learning and intelligent algorithms to detect, respond to, and even predict cyber threats in real time. By integrating AI into industrial cybersecurity frameworks, organizations can strengthen their defenses, ensure operational continuity, and protect valuable assets from malicious threats.
